  • Abstract
    Multi-vehicle ride matching problem studies how to take passengers as much as possible through optimizing vehicles´ route and matching between vehicles and passengers. But at present, problems exist in the researches like that models divorced from reality and low efficiency of algorithms. For this problem, this paper presents a solution based on clustering of vehicles´ route order. Transferring the MRMP to RMP through clustering of vehicles´ route order, it forms the first matching result between vehicles and passengers. And looking for the best sort order through sorting the first matching result making use of priori clustering. At last, we optimize the solution one times more through optimized rules. Experimental result shows that, the method based on clustering of vehicles´ route order can solve the problem with high matching efficiency and low cost.
